Description
American (Ohio), late 18th Century. Cherry with poplar secondary. Lid with applied edge moldings, dovetailed case, three lower dovetailed drawers with tiger maple fronts, bracket feet with ornately scrolled apron and interior lidded till. Old finish, age splits, shrinkage and wear. 23"h. 42.25"w. 19.25''d. Ex David and Margret Davis (Ohio). Came from an old Ashland, Ohio collection and was originally purchased from an estate west of Shelby, Ohio.
Condition
Feet look good, some shrinkage, finish wear, right cornice of molding over drawers has been broken off and replaced with putty.
